Ceramic foam filters offer a simple, reliable and costeffective method to remove inclusions. Filtering with CFF is a supplement to metal treatment within the furnace, such as fluxing and degassing or inline filtration.

Ceramic foam filters have an open pore reticulated structure with very high porosity and surface area to trap inclusions. The open foam structures are compose of ceramic material, such as alumina, mullite or silica. Alumina is the most common filter material. Ceramic foam filters operate in a deep bed filtration mode where inclusions smaller than the pore openings are retained throughout the cross-section of the filter.

CFFs typically are a polyurethane foam coated with a ceramic slurry then dried and fired. During firing, the polyurethane foam dissipates leaving behind a porous ceramic structure. The ceramic can be a phosphate-bonded alumina and pore sizes and thicknesses can vary.
